Responsibilities

  • Support treasury pre-close due diligence, deal funding, and post-close integrations for acquisitions and strategic financial investments.
  • Analyze target company’s treasury operations, focusing on cash management structures, banking relationships, debt and financial risks.
  • Develop and execute detailed integration plans to merge acquired company’s treasury functions into Google’s existing framework. Track project milestones and update workflow tools accordingly.
  • Manage internal and external stakeholders, serving as the key point of contact to advocate for treasury within the context of fast-paced decision-making and a high degree of ambiguity.
  • Partner cross-functionally to optimize problem-solving and increase efficiencies, leveraging banking relationships to achieve timely results.
